Enroll, delete, or reset a Qolsys IQ Dimmer (QZ2140-840)

The IQ Dimmer (QZ2140-840) can be enrolled into or deleted from a Z-Wave network following the instructions below.

To enroll an IQ Dimmer (QZ2140-840) into a Z-Wave network:

  1. Place the Z-Wave controller into Add Mode.
  2. Plug in the device.
  3. Press the trigger button on the front of the device.
  4. Verify that the device shows up on the Alarm.com customer website or Alarm.com app and responds to commands to turn the Qolsys IQ Z-Wave Outlet on/off.

To delete an IQ Dimmer (QZ2140-840) from a Z-Wave network:

  1. Place the Z-Wave controller into Delete Mode.
  2. Press the trigger button on the front of the device.
  3. The controller should indicate that the device was removed successfully.

To reset an IQ Dimmer (QZ2140-840):

  1. Unplug the IQ Outlet from the AC outlet as well as the power plug of the appliance from the IQ Dimmer (if plugged in).
  2. Press and hold the trigger button on the front of the device.
  3. Plug the IQ Dimmer back into the AC outlet with the button pressed. After 3 seconds, release the button.
  4. If you see the button blink, that means that IQ Outlet has been reset successfully.
